The carbon emissions of the healthcare industry account for about 5% of global emissions, with over half of the emissions coming from the manufacturing supply chain, which consumes about 25% of the total emissions of the healthcare industry. China has become an important market for global pharmaceutical production and manufacturing, so reaching this cooperation in China is of great significance for reducing large-scale carbon emissions in the healthcare industry.
It is worth mentioning that four out of the five global healthcare giants are members of the Global Council Health Systems Working Group of the Sustainable Markets Initiative, and Far East Energy is also a member of the China Council Health Systems Working Group of the initiative. The Sustainable Markets Initiative was founded by then Crown Prince and current King Charles III of the United Kingdom in 2020 and has now become the "preferred" organization for private sector participation in sustainable development transformation worldwide.
